Output 131637b90cbab9cf2ef07539e31a1d6d5e52e3152599cd8235437fa586ca108a:16

value
105423600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aacd26cf08bbeda483049eb12f9d9b6f954ea2b OP_EQUALVERIFY OP_CHECKSIG
address
16MFE1SBP4Z6rUfJsYdkzFa4GdBkeVm68G
transaction
131637b90cbab9cf2ef07539e31a1d6d5e52e3152599cd8235437fa586ca108a
spent
true